AI agent insurers
The new category insuring businesses against losses caused by AI.
AIUC
Combines a certification standard (AIUC-1), independent audits, and insurance for AI agents
Armilla
Purpose-built AI liability insurance for generative AI and AI agents, plus independent AI verification and assessments
Klaimee
Liability insurance plus certification for autonomous AI agents, covering losses traditional E&O and cyber exclude
Mount
AI-native insurance carrier for deployed autonomous AI agents; product is ActiveCover
Testudo
Lloyd's coverholder writing standalone generative AI liability insurance for US companies, on an E&S basis

ICHRA & HRA administrators
Platforms that move employer money to employees tax-free under an HRA rule. They administer, they do not carry risk.
StretchDollar
Small-business ICHRA: fixed pre-tax allowance, employees buy their own individual plans
Take Command
Pioneering, end-to-end ICHRA + QSEHRA administration for employers of all sizes
Thatch
All-in-one ICHRA: employer sets a budget, employees pick their own plans; leftover budget via a Thatch Visa card
Zorro
AI-powered ICHRA platform with a strong broker channel (plan design + decision support + admin)
